高管和你只有这两个区别

存储架构 2016-11-07 阅读原文

郑昀 2016/11

领导和群众可能只有这两个区别。

第一,

领导肾好。

为什么肾好?

因为领导站着说话不腰疼。

所以领导可以天天琢磨 Make Things Happen Or Not Happen。

为什么领导要这么说话?

我以前经常说要学会“跳出三界外,不在五行中”,学会“低头拉车,抬头看路”。WHY?

群众通常会因为当下的状态虽说有些微刺痛,有些微不爽,但还都能忍受。

如果要改变现状,第一,不知道要改成什么,需要动脑筋,需要逻辑,谁来定方向?第二,貌似要付出一定代价,等于说是给自己找麻烦,成不成且说呢,第三,不仅仅是给自己找麻烦,还要动员其他人和其他部门。

群众普遍肾不好,吃瓜的都吃的扶墙走,劳碌命的都忙得四脚跳,哪有余命接大招。

然而,以前我讲过问题守恒定律,解决一个问题会引起另一个新问题,问题生生不息。

譬如控制人口和老龄化社会。譬如拉动内需刺激汽车消费和限行限购。

仅就眼前的问题见招拆招肯定是不行的,谁能先跳脱出来,谁就是“领导”。这也是很多CEO具备”风雷动“能力的原因。

反过来说,既然我们现在遇到的困境,是之前的认知模式和工作模式造成的,那么如果继续沿用旧思维自然没用。谁能先抬头看路,谁就是“领导”。

譬如说,Hadoop版本混乱多变,CDH你选哪个版本,集群管理和调度你选谁,选Java还是Scala,Scala、Spark升级了、语法变了,你跟不跟?Zeppelin要不要跟?Alluxio要不要跟?

每样都跟,你业务还做不做?

于是,我们决定,首先在上层结构上把商业智能开发、测试和发布的流程贯穿起来,提高数据部门的生产效率。

数据,能共享。

流程,能流转。

资源,能看见。

经验,能固化(为代码)。

在底层结构上,再封装一层,基于Mesos进行资源调度、基于Alluxio做高速存储、基于Spark做批量计算、基于Storm做实时计算、基于Zeppelin做交互查询等等的整套BDAS大数据分析栈,职责转交运维部。

我们的目的是,第一提升数据部门的生产效率,把细节尽量屏蔽,尽量don’t make me think,第二至少能把集群的计算能力暴露出去,让数据部门之外的每一位开发者也能不敢说无障碍地,至少痛苦没那么多地参与离线计算和实时计算。

领导的肾还是比较强悍的,所以口吐莲花之后,大家克服了好多困难,在百忙之中一样一样落地生根。

第二,

信息不对称。

你急,领导不急。

如前所述,由于“肾功能”不一样,由于职责分工不一样,就是会出现你知道的他都知道,你不知道的他也知道。

我曾在微博上说过:危急时刻走“弓背路(林彪语)”一次两次可以,老走就太伤感情了,连林彪都要投诉主席四渡赤水的战略意图不明,军心不稳。其实是总部破译了敌军电文密码,掌握了敌方活动,但主席不敢说。这事儿吧就比较尴尬。

总结一下,领导和群众其实差别不大,视野、高度和宽度都能达到,如果能肾再好一点,多抬头看路,信息再透明一点(太理想化了啊啊啊),可能人人都是CTO。

为什么是CTO不是CEO?

因为CEO实在是注定孤独注定痛苦的物种,实在是不可描述。

-EOF-

欢迎订阅我的微信订阅号『老兵笔记』

责编内容by:旁观者-郑昀 【阅读原文】。感谢您的支持!

您可能感兴趣的

Spark2.0.2+Zeppelin0.6.2 环境搭建入门初探 0.抱怨与其他(此部分与标题没有太多联系): 首先一点想说的是版本问题,为什么标题我会写清楚版本号呢!原因就是版本不对真的很会坑人。 就在写这篇文...
Introduction to Oracle Big Data Cloud Service – Co... This is my forth blog post about Oracle Big Data Cloud Service – Compute Edit...
#167: TimescaleDB, DynamoDB, Presto and Zeppelin LinkedIn's Strategy for Migrating to Its Own Database — LinkedIn’s ...
One of Ethereum’s Earliest Smart Contract La... Serpent, one of ethereum's earlier smart contracting languages is no longer safe...
同程旅游实时计算的演进 同程旅游 (LY.COM) 是一家专业的一站式旅游预订平台,提供近万家景点门票、特价机票、出国旅游、周边游、自驾游及酒店预订服务 ; 专业旅游线路服务。全年公司...